For whatever strange reason, Volkswagen is sponsoring Discovery Channel's 25th Shark. Usually, that would have meant a big VW logo on your screen during the commercials or Little Vader making a guest appearance, but no, they’ve taken things much further.
For whatever reason, some people who know more about these killers of the ocean than we do built a shark cage that looks like the Beetle. It comes with wheels and tires, brakes, a steering wheel and the overall shape of the 2013 Beetle. That’s about all we could see in the short trailer, but you’ll be able to find out more once Shark Week begins August 12th.
